WebAug 19, 2024 · Paint the outside by using a brush or spouncer. Use thin coats and let dry between coats. OR you can paint the inside by swirling the paint around until coated. Pour the excess back into the bottle. Then let the jar dry upside down on a piece of wax paper to drain the excess. Move the jar around frequently. This keeps the jar from moving around. Keep … pinthouse round rockWebApr 27, 2024 · How to make frosted glass mason jar picture frames: Mix the marbling medium with the frosted glass paint. I mixed it 2 parts marbling medium to 1 part paint. The instructions on the bottle say to mix 1 to 1 but I wanted a more transparent look to the jars so I used less paint.
